Abstract

The article examines the psychological aspect of juvenile offending. Along with social conditions, adolescents’ internal psychological characteristics also influence the formation of such behavior. Therefore, studying the defense mechanisms and coping strategies of juvenile offenders is of both scientific and practical importance.

The aim of the study was to identify the features of psychological defense mechanisms and coping strategies among juvenile offenders and to analyze the relationship between them.

The research material was collected using psychodiagnostic methods. These methods were used to assess defense mechanisms and coping strategies. Group comparisons and data processing were carried out with comparative-analytical and statistical procedures.

The group comparison revealed statistically significant differences in projection, displacement, compensation, regression, and repression. The emotional coping score was higher in some offender groups, whereas behavioral coping was more pronounced in the control group. Correlation analysis showed that defense mechanisms and coping strategies are interrelated.

The scientific novelty of the study lies in the joint analysis of the relationship between defense mechanisms and coping strategies of juvenile offenders on the basis of empirical data. The findings clarify the psychological features of deviant behavior and may be used in psychological support for juveniles and in the prevention of offending.
